推荐开源项目:Easy Move & Resize - 简化窗口管理的高效工具

EasyMove&Resize是一个基于C#和.NETFramework的窗口管理工具,通过WindowsAPI和全局键盘钩子实现窗口移动和调整。它支持自定义快捷键,轻量级且易于集成,适用于多任务处理、编程、设计和演示等多种场景,旨在提高桌面生产力。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

推荐开源项目:Easy Move & Resize - 简化窗口管理的高效工具

easy-move-resizeAdds "modifier key + mouse drag" move and resize to OSX项目地址:https://gitcode.com/gh_mirrors/ea/easy-move-resize

项目简介

在日常工作中,我们经常需要在多个应用窗口间切换和调整大小以优化工作空间。 是一个为提高效率而设计的小巧实用的工具,它允许用户通过快捷键轻松地移动和调整Windows上的应用程序窗口。

技术分析

Easy Move & Resize 使用C#语言编写,并基于.NET Framework。其核心功能实现主要依靠Windows API,特别是FindWindowSetWindowPos 函数,用于识别并操作窗口的位置和大小。此外,项目还利用全局键盘钩子(Global Keyboard Hooks)来捕获和响应用户定义的快捷键。开发者 David Marcotte 巧妙地封装了这些复杂功能,提供了一个简单易用的接口供用户配置和使用。

主要特性

  1. 自定义快捷键:你可以按照个人习惯设置移动和缩放窗口的快捷键,例如,按住Ctrl+Alt,再用方向键就可以快速移动窗口到屏幕的四个角落。
  2. 无侵入性:Easy Move & Resize 在后台运行,不会干扰你的其他工作,只有在按下指定快捷键时才会生效。
  3. 轻量级:项目的体积小巧,对系统资源占用极低,不影响系统性能。
  4. 易于集成:作为一个独立的可执行文件,它可以方便地与任何启动器或自动运行程序集成,以满足不同用户的个性化需求。

应用场景

  • 多任务处理:对于需要同时打开多个应用程序的多任务工作者来说,这款工具可以快速整理窗口布局,提高工作效率。
  • 程序员:编程时,常常需要将代码编辑器、终端和文档等窗口排列得整整齐齐,Easy Move & Resize 能让你的屏幕布局更加有序。
  • 设计师:在进行多图层或多个设计元素对比时,一键调整窗口位置和大小,让比对变得更加便捷。
  • 演示者:准备演讲或展示时,能够快速将窗口定位到理想位置,避免杂乱无章的画面影响专业形象。

结语

Easy Move & Resize 提供了一种简洁高效的方式来管理电脑桌面窗口,它简化了繁琐的手动调整过程,释放了时间去专注于更重要的工作。无论是专业人士还是普通用户,都能从中受益。如果你一直在寻找提升桌面生产力的方法,不妨试试这个开源项目吧!

easy-move-resizeAdds "modifier key + mouse drag" move and resize to OSX项目地址:https://gitcode.com/gh_mirrors/ea/easy-move-resize

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

周琰策Scott

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值